diff options
author | Nishanth Menon <nm@ti.com> | 2014-06-26 09:10:20 +0200 |
---|---|---|
committer | Jason Cooper <jason@lakedaemon.net> | 2014-06-30 21:11:17 +0200 |
commit | 6f16fc878a51572a998655e5ef1c396cb269648d (patch) | |
tree | e97ef38d5c8a50c26dc9eefb8648700f81cf27b4 /Documentation/devicetree/bindings/arm/omap/crossbar.txt | |
parent | irqchip: crossbar: Dont use '0' to mark reserved interrupts (diff) | |
download | linux-6f16fc878a51572a998655e5ef1c396cb269648d.tar.xz linux-6f16fc878a51572a998655e5ef1c396cb269648d.zip |
irqchip: crossbar: Check for premapped crossbar before allocating
If irq_of_parse_and_map is executed twice, the same crossbar is mapped to two
different GIC interrupts. This is completely undesirable. Instead, check
if the requested crossbar event is pre-allocated and provide that GIC
mapping back to caller if already allocated.
Signed-off-by: Nishanth Menon <nm@ti.com>
Signed-off-by: Sricharan R <r.sricharan@ti.com>
Acked-by: Santosh Shilimkar <santosh.shilimkar@ti.com>
Link: https://lkml.kernel.org/r/1403766634-18543-3-git-send-email-r.sricharan@ti.com
Signed-off-by: Jason Cooper <jason@lakedaemon.net>
Diffstat (limited to 'Documentation/devicetree/bindings/arm/omap/crossbar.txt')
0 files changed, 0 insertions, 0 deletions